Air Canada Unveils Resumption of International Schedule this Summer

Air Canada has announced it’s resuming over a dozen global routes as part of its planned resumption of service. Specifically, it's relaunching 17 routes and 11 destinations around the world.

“As travel restrictions ease across the globe, we are committed to rebuild our international network and continue as a global carrier to connect Canada to the world, while also developing additional markets and targeting new opportunities,” said Mark Galardo, the senior vice president of network planning and revenue management at Air Canada.

“Canadians are eager to travel again, and we are ready to reunite customers with their families and friends. With vaccination rates globally increasing and our industry-leading CleanCare+ bio-safety protocols, Air Canada has your health and safety as its top priority.”

Starting 01AUG, Air Canada’s Calgary to Frankfurt route will resume four times weekly. A new addition will be a non-stop service from Montreal to Cairo three times weekly.

The company will also consider reopening more routes as travel restrictions change in the coming weeks and months.

Previously, Air Canada had already resumed flights to Athens, Dubai, Rome, Lisbon, Casablanca, and London and the company says it may increase the frequency of those flights as time goes on as well.

Air Canada’s newly-announced additions to its international schedule this summer are as follows:

International flight schedule for Summer 2021

Route Frequency Start Date
YYC-FRA Up to 4x weekly 01AUG, 2021
YYZ-VIE 3x weekly 21JUL, 2021
YYZ-DUB 3x weekly 01AUG, 2021
YYZ-CDG Up to 5x weekly 02AUG, 2021
YYZ-ZRH 4x weekly 03AUG, 2021
YUL-GVA 3x weekly 22JUL, 2021
YUL-TLV 2x weekly 1AUG, 2021
YUL-YXU Up to 4x weekly 3AUG, 2021
